Originally from the UK, Andy first worked on earthquake-driven coastal deformation in the eastern Mediterranean, having decided to do a PhD based on the promise of snorkelling and Greek food. He has been in Aotearoa since 2017 and still works on coastal deformation, most recently studying the Kaikōura earthquake and the prehistoric earthquakes affecting the east coast of North Island. In Our Changing Coast, Andy leads the development of probabilistic models that estimate how likely (and by how much) different parts of Aotearoa’s coastline are to be affected by earthquakes in the next 100 years.
